It's no secret I want to have my own invitation business. I've been thinking about it for almost a year now honestly. I've done so much research on what is out there that it's almost overwhelming. Nonetheless, I do know that when I do start my own projects (once the photography thing transitions a bit more to Jill and when I have more extraneous money), I'd like to incorporate handmade stamping into my invitations. In the invitation business, everything is either digitally printed or letterpressed. Digital is cheaper but doesn't offer the handmade feel and letterpress offer the extreme handmade feel but is hella expensive. So I think I want to combine the two. The whole reason I even wanted to do invitations was so I could use my hands and have fun compiling all of the components. I actually like mundane work like that.
